About the Role:

DCY is seeking a talented and motivated ML Engineer, Researcher in Signal domain. DCY is the corporate research division that focuses on advanced technology development for applications across all DCY product lines including Automotive, Lifestyle (consumer), and Professional.


The Machine Learning Engineer will be responsible for the development for advanced car driver state analysis systems.


You will be responsible for translating complex analytical concepts into actionable results for our research. As a Data Scientist on the DCY Neurosense team, you will work with a world-class multidisciplinary team to deploy scalable predictive reasoning and data mining algorithms, as well as extract / transform Big Data. Provide technical expertise and business consultative skills to address supervised and unsupervised learning problems in an applied automotive analytics environments. You will also be directly responsible for preparing, analyzing and generating effective project results in an efficient and errorless manner using classical statistical techniques as well as advanced tools, delivered on time and on budget.


This position will be located in Yerevan, Armenia, where the successful candidate will have access to world class tools and facilities.

Your Team:

This position has no direct reports.

What You Will Do:

  • Work with state-of-the-art neural network models for Signals (some times computer vision) and biometrics
  • Work with biosignals such as heart rate/ECG/32 channel EEG
  • Work with big car data from a multitude of sensors
  • Select statistical, machine learning and artificial intelligence algorithms to solve filtering, clustering and classification problems.
  • Work with time series, knowledge of spectral and non-linear ways of representing signals.
  • Handle large-scale data sets and organization of relevant data
  • Work closely with other senior machine learning researchers and engineers in autonomy
  • As part of a matrix organization work with engineers, designers, testers and managers as needed to help integrate, evaluate and productize your solutions
  • Perform code reviews and other activities to ensure high-quality results
  • Analyze, write and adapt software requirements
  • Provide data/report support for complex data mining projects.
  • Conceptualize problems, apply appropriate theory, explore approaches, simulate, and implement with minimal supervision.
  • Define data needs, evaluate data quality, and extract/transform data for analytic projects and research.
